Safety Recalls (4)

Official safety recall campaigns filed with NHTSA

  1. Manufacturer action

    Recall campaign 20V716000

    Report date
    Component:
    BACK OVER PREVENTION
    Consequence:
    A black or frozen rear view image reduces the driver's visibility when reversing, increasing the risk of a crash.
    Remedy:
    Volkswagen will notify owners, and dealers will update the infotainment system software, free of charge. The recall began December 11, 2020. Owners may contact Volkswagen customer service at 1-800-893-5298. Volkswagen's number for this recall is 91BB/91BC.

  2. Manufacturer action

    Recall campaign 21V038000

    Report date
    Component:
    Not available in the source record
    Consequence:
    The seat can move front and back without restriction if bolts are missing, increasing the risk of injury during a crash.
    Remedy:
    Volkswagen will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the front seat tracks and, as necessary, install the bolts, free of charge. The recall began February 18, 2021. Owners may contact Volkswagen customer service at 1-800-893-5298. Volkswagen's number for this recall is 72L6.

  3. Manufacturer action

    Recall campaign 21V492000

    Report date
    Component:
    AIR BAGS
    Consequence:
    Incorrect positioning of the air bag control module can cause the vehicle's air bags to deploy improperly during a crash, increasing the risk of injury. Additionally, the vehicle's air bags can deploy unintentionally, increasing the risk of a crash.
    Remedy:
    Dealers will replace the air bag control module,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ed on January 28, 2022. Owners may contact Volkswagen customer service at 1-800-893-5298. Volkswagen's number for this recall is 69CK.

  4. Manufacturer action

    Recall campaign 22V514000

    Report date
    Component:
    BACK OVER PREVENTION
    Consequence:
    A rearview camera that does not display an image reduces the driver's rear view, increasing the risk of a crash.
    Remedy:
    Dealers will update the infotainment software,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ed September 16, 2022. Owners may contact Volkswagen's customer service at 1-800-893-5298. Volkswagen's number for this recall is 91DV.
